But don’t just listen to God’s word. You must do what it says. Otherwise, you are only fooling yourselves. For if you listen to the word and don’t obey, it is like glancing at your face in a mirror. You see yourself, walk away, and forget what you look like. But if you look carefully into the perfect law that sets you free, and if you do what it says and don’t forget what you heard, then God will bless you for doing it. (James 1:22-25) We sometimes forget God's Word is more than a message we merely hear. We must take it a step further - obedience. Obedience to God's Word may seem to be a bit 'unconventional' to the majority who surround you, but it doesn't make it okay to ignore it. It is not obeyed in bits and pieces, but in its entirety. It was given to us to help us know God, understand how he works and moves, and to pattern our lives accordingly.
